Collecting Drinking Water from Roofs in Five Steps

In New Zealand, approximately 10% of the population relies on rainwater collected from roofs for their daily water needs. There are also an increasing number of projects looking for sustainable and cost-effective solutions to harvest rainwater as a reliable source for drinking water. The key to ensuring the safety and quality of water lies in proper collection, storage, adherence to regulatory standards, and the crucial step of effective filtration.

Spare a thought for the builders… Building Material Prices Predicted to Continue Rising

2022 Q1 construction supply chain update

Following a 34% increase over the last 12 months, building product suppliers are estimating a further 11% increase in the price of their products over the next 6 months, according to the latest EBOSS Construction Supply Chain Update.
